What is needed to do a real car cleaning?

By Lulu September 27th, 2024

A full detailing approach involves meticulous cleaning, restoration, and protection of both the interior and exterior of the vehicle. Here’s a step-by-step guide to achieving a complete detail:

Exterior Detailing

    1.Pre-Wash

    Rinse: Use a pressure washer or hose to remove loose dirt and debris.
    Foam Cannon: Apply a layer of foam wash to break down grime.

    2.Wheels and Tires

    Wheel Cleaner: Apply a dedicated cleaner and let it dwell.
    Brushes: Use brushes to scrub the wheels and tires.
    Rinse: Thoroughly rinse off all cleaners.

    3.Washing the Body

    Two-Bucket Method: Fill one bucket with soapy water and the other with clean water.
    Wash Mitt: Use a microfiber mitt to wash the car in sections, rinsing the mitt frequently.

    4.Clay Bar Treatment

    Clay Bar: Use a clay bar with lubricant to remove embedded contaminants.
    Rinse: Rinse the car again after claying.

    5.Paint Correction (if needed)

    Polish: Use a dual-action polisher with appropriate polishing compounds to correct swirl marks and scratches.
    Compound (if necessary): Use a heavier compound for deeper scratches before finishing with a polish.

    6.Waxing or Sealing

    Wax/Sealant: Apply a quality wax or sealant for protection. Follow product instructions for application and curing time.

    7.Glass Cleaning

    Glass Cleaner: Clean all windows and mirrors using a streak-free glass cleaner.

    8.Trim and Plastics

    Trim Restorer: Apply a trim restorer to any faded plastic or rubber surfaces.


    Interior Detailing

    1.Vacuuming

    Thorough Vacuum: Vacuum the entire interior, including seats, carpets, and floor mats. Use attachments for tight spaces.

    2.Carpet and Upholstery Cleaning

    Spot Cleaner: Treat any stains with an appropriate upholstery cleaner.
    Steam Clean (optional): Use a steam cleaner for deep cleaning fabrics.

    3.Leather Cleaning and Conditioning

    Leather Cleaner: Clean all leather surfaces.
    Conditioner: Apply a leather conditioner to keep the leather supple and prevent cracking.

    4.Dashboard and Surfaces

    All-Purpose Cleaner: Wipe down the dashboard, center console, and door panels.
    Detailing Brushes: Use to clean vents and intricate areas.

    5.Windows and Mirrors

    Glass Cleaner: Wipe down all interior glass surfaces.

    6.Odor Elimination

    Odor Neutralizer: Use an odor eliminator or an air freshener for a pleasant scent.


    Final Touches

    • Tire Shine: Apply tire shine for a polished look.
    • Final Inspection: Walk around the vehicle to ensure all areas are clean and touch up any missed spots.
